One Dead King is always present on that tower top (unless he has fell off the bridge and onto the ground floor)

There is never more than one. In this case there was probably a quadruple spawn bug.

One Dead King is one of the few fixed spawns in that area as far as i have experienced.

The multi spawn problem usually only happens in case the server is reloaded without a restart. How ever this shouldn't happen THAT often on the gameserver.
